UIV Fund Management is a global impact investment platform dedicated to driving positive change through capital and expertise. We focus on three core themes—urban tech, energy transition, and financial inclusion—delivering both direct investments and tailored mandates. We support UHNW investors and family offices with bespoke investment services, and provide management and restructuring solutions for impact-driven firms and funds worldwide.

UIV Fund I  is the inaugural fund of UIV Fund Management, one of the first SFDR Article 9 funds in Europe, established to demonstrate that sustainable urban transformation can deliver both measurable impact and competitive financial returns. The Fund invests in Europe and USA with a focus on growth-stage companies developing scalable solutions for decarbonization and circularity.

Impact Opportunities II

Impact Opportunities II targets significant minority and majority positions in impact-driven scale-up companies active in Energy Transition and Financial Inclusion, primarily across Global Frontier and Emerging Markets.     

OASIS Energy Transition Fund

The investment objective of the Fund is to deploy private equity investments in different energy access business models in developing and frontier markets.

Bamboo Financial Inclusion Fund I

The Financial Inclusion Fund invests in microfinance institutions which improve access, affordability, appropriateness of financial products or services generating livelihood opportunities for low income people. The Fund delivers social impact on top of financial returns to investors. 

Bamboo Financial Inclusion Fund II

The Financial Inclusion Fund II invests primarily in microfinance institutions and inclusive banking institutions responsibly serving the micro, small, and medium-sized enterprises, as well as fintech companies involved in developing products and delivery channels that contribute to more efficient and effective delivery of financial services to disadvantaged populations.
